Original Description
El Greco's A Prelate 2 mesmerizes with its haunting intensity, embodying the artist's signature fusion of Byzantine mysticism and Mannerist drama. Painted circa 1600 during his Toledo period, the portrait captures an unnamed clergyman with elongated features and piercing eyes that seem to transcend the canvas. The dark, somber palette—dominated by blacks and earthy tones—heightens the spiritual gravity, while the flickering brushwork lends an almost otherworldly vitality. As a key figure of the Spanish Renaissance, El Greco defied naturalism, using distortion to convey inner turmoil and divine connection. This work exemplifies his late style, where form dissolves into expressive energy, cementing his posthumous reputation as a proto-modernist whose influence resonated centuries later.
